Meta to buy Chinese founded startup Manus to boost advanced AI
Manus valued at $2 billion to $3 billion, source says

Published 5 months ago on Dec 30th 2025, 11:51 pm
By Web Desk
Reuters: Meta (META.O), opens new tab said on Monday it would acquire Chinese-founded artificial intelligence startup Manus, as the technology giant accelerates efforts to integrate advanced AI across its platforms.
Financial terms of the transaction were not released, but a source with direct knowledge of the matter said the deal values the Singapore-based firm at between $2 billion and $3 billion.
